Ticket: DEDUP-412 — Connection failures during customer record dedup

The Larkspur dedup job started failing overnight with pool exhaustion errors. It merges duplicate customer records in batches of 500, but the batch worker isn't releasing connections after a merge conflict, so the pool drains within twenty minutes. Proposed fix: wrap merges in a try/finally release and cap retries at three. For the sync, reproduce against staging using the connection string below.

primary connection of bagep-kaweg = clickhouse://rusdor_svc:3TXlgH7O8DuUYI@db-ae3f.zarqelgrid.internal:5432/zordor

# Zero-downtime migration config — Brindlewick Catalog DB
# Expand/contract only: add columns nullable, backfill via the Ferrow job,
# then drop in a later release. Never run DDL and backfill in one deploy.
# MIGRATION_LOCK_TIMEOUT stays at 5s; raise it and you stall the pool.
# Weekly sync agreed: the migration runner authenticates with its own
# credential rather than the app role. That credential belongs on the
# very next line of this file.

env line for fafof-fahag: LEDGER_TOKEN5=f8790

## Provenance: Pairline Matcher GC Pauses

Support reference for the Pairline matching service at Orvetta. Recent builds switched the collector to a low-pause mode after customers reported match requests stalling for up to four seconds during peak load. Each deployed binary now embeds its build record, so when a customer reports a stall, you can tell engineering exactly which build they hit. Before filing, grab the token shown directly below this line.

session token of tajef-bageg = htk21_5d90d574934f3ccae6437

## Deploy Step 4 — Session Token Fix

Heads up: this release patches the Fernbrook session-token refresh bug where tokens expired mid-refresh and users got bounced to login. After deploying, flush the token cache on both app nodes or stale tokens will linger for an hour. Don't skip the cache flush — we learned that the hard way. The deploy bundle must be verified with the key below.

deploy key for kajof-fajop: bky6_gDHw9Q